It really helps to split things up into manageable tasks, but you have to be realistic, and even over estimate the time needed.
Nothing ever works out as easy as we expect, and working from home you are guaranteed to have some distraction.
You'll be surprised how nice it feels to finish a simple task, and even better when something actually does go better than expected.
This works even better when you tie it into other daily tasks like exercise, which is something you should be doing anyway.
Basically look at this as taking care of, and even improving yourself rather than just making a game.
